The necessity of accountable adoption and possession of Pocket Pitbulls
Responsible adoption and ownership of Pocket Pitbulls are paramount in ensuring that these dogs thrive in their new homes. Prospective adopters should take the time to educate themselves about the breed's characteristics, potential challenges, and care requirements before making a commitment. Understanding that owning a dog is a long-term responsibility—often lasting 10 to 15 years—can help prevent impulsive decisions that may lead to abandonment or neglect.
Moreover, responsible ownership includes proper training and socialization from an early age. This not only helps prevent behavioral issues but also promotes positive interactions with other pets and people. It is essential for owners to be proactive in seeking out training resources or classes that can assist in developing good manners and obedience skills in their Pocket Pitbulls.
By fostering a loving environment built on trust and respect, owners can ensure that their Pocket Pitbulls lead happy, fulfilling lives while contributing positively to their communities.
